Keypad Entry Systems

Keypad entry remains the workhorse for Bloomington’s multi-user properties — ranchettes with farmhands, family compounds, or contractor yards where several people need access without carrying remotes. We install and repair weather-rated keypads that survive the Inland Empire’s temperature swings, from 105°F August afternoons to frost-laced January mornings. On older Bloomington tract homes near Valley Boulevard, we frequently replace original keypads where moisture intrusion has corroded the contact pads. New installs on agricultural gates get marine-grade housings and extended-duty relays because those gates cycle harder than standard residential units.

Remote Control Programming & Replacement

Lost remotes, dead transmitters, or interference from nearby industrial equipment — we program replacement remotes and diagnose signal issues across all nine brands we service. For Bloomington properties with metal buildings or extensive steel fencing, we check for RF dead zones that can plague remote systems. We stock common remote frequencies and can often hand you a programmed replacement the same day rather than ordering for later delivery.

Phone Entry & Intercom Systems

Phone entry systems let you verify visitors before opening the gate, critical for Bloomington properties set back from the road with limited sightlines. We install cellular-based phone entry units where landline infrastructure is absent or unreliable — common on outlying ranchette parcels — and repair existing systems with damaged call boxes or wiring compromised by rodent activity in the agricultural areas. Our Gate Access Control team can integrate phone entry with your existing gate operator or spec a complete new system.

Card Reader Access Control

Card readers suit Bloomington’s commercial-adjacent properties: contractor yards, small fleet operations, or multi-family setups where you need audit trails of who entered when. We install proximity card systems and can set up tiered access levels — full access for owners, time-restricted entry for employees, one-time codes for deliveries. The card readers we spec for Bloomington’s dusty, high-heat environment carry higher IP ratings than standard residential units.

Video Intercom Systems

Video intercom adds visual verification to gate access, letting you see who’s at your entry point before remotely releasing the gate. For Bloomington’s longer driveways and set-back properties, this eliminates the uncertainty of audio-only systems. We install weather-rated cameras with infrared night vision and can run dedicated low-voltage lines or configure wireless bridge setups where trenching isn’t practical. Integration with smartphone apps means you can see and release your gate from anywhere — useful when the feed truck arrives while you’re in town.

Smart Access Integration

Smart access lets you control your Bloomington gate from your phone, set temporary codes for visitors, and receive entry alerts. We configure systems that work with existing operators where possible, or spec complete smart-ready setups for new installations. For properties with spotty cellular coverage, we’ll test signal strength at your gate location before recommending a specific system — there’s no point installing an app-dependent controller that can’t connect.

Common Gate Access Control Problems We See in Bloomington Homes

  • Keypad failure after heat exposure. Bloomington’s 105–110°F summer peaks cook standard residential keypads. We replace them with high-temp-rated units, or relocate the pad to a shaded post where possible. Internal solder joints crack from thermal cycling; we see this every August.
  • Post anchor pullout in sandy soil. The loosely compacted ground throughout 92316 doesn’t hold standard concrete footings well, especially when Santa Ana winds hit in fall. We replaced a failed LiftMaster slide gate operator on a Cypress Avenue property where informal trucking staging had worn the original residential-grade motor to near-commercial duty. The sandy soil required us to set deeper concrete footings and re-anchor the posts to prevent future pullout during Santa Ana wind events.
  • Accelerated wear on heavy-duty slide gates. Bloomington’s informal trucking staging and auto storage yards cycle steel slide gates at near-commercial frequency. Residential-grade access control components — chains, rollers, gearboxes — fail prematurely. We upgrade these to commercial-duty hardware during repair.
  • Aluminum frame warping causing track bind. Summer heat expansion warps aluminum gate frames, making them stick in slide tracks. The access control system thinks the gate is blocked and faults out. We diagnose whether it’s a control issue or physical binding, then address the root cause.

Pricing for Gate Access Control in Bloomington, CA

Service Typical Range in Bloomington
Keypad entry repair $180–$340
Keypad entry replacement (new install) $450–$720
Remote control programming (per remote) $65–$120
Phone entry system repair $220–$480
Phone entry system (new cellular-based) $890–$1,450
Card reader installation $680–$1,200
Video intercom (single gate, basic) $750–$1,350
Smart access integration (retrofit) $520–$980
Complete access control system (new gate) $1,450–$2,800

What moves you within these ranges: gate size and weight (agricultural swing gates need heavier-duty components), whether we can reuse existing low-voltage wiring, and whether San Bernardino County permitting is required for new automated installations.
